Hi Gentlemen,

  • I have a main primary network which is a modem (192.168.1.1) connected to a WAN network and supply an internet to my house. I connected another modem as secondary to the main modem through Ethernet with ip address 192.168.0.1. 

    How can I connect from a device in the primary network remotely to a device in the secondary network? As both devices got different ip address 192.168.1.34 and 192.268.0.7

  - When using two modems , you may not use the DHCP service on the secondary modem (turn it off in it's configuration) , to avoid address conflicts  ; so that the clients can only see one authoritative DHCP server (on the primary)
